The location of the university also matters. Is it in a bustling city, a quiet suburb, or a rural area? City universities often offer more opportunities for internships and networking, while rural campuses might provide a more focused and tight-knit community. The surrounding environment can significantly impact a student's social life, extracurricular activities, and overall well-being. For instance, studying in New York City might expose Jose to a diverse range of cultural experiences, while a university in a smaller town might offer a stronger sense of community and easier access to nature.

Don't forget the Location, Location, Location! Is it in a bustling city, a quiet suburb, or a rural area? The location of the university affects everything from internship opportunities to social life. Studying in a city offers access to a diverse range of cultural experiences and professional opportunities, while studying in a rural area might provide a more peaceful and focused environment.
Finally, the Alumni Network is key. Does the university have a strong and active alumni network? A strong alumni network can provide valuable mentorships, networking opportunities, and career connections for Jose after graduation. It also reflects the university's reputation and the success of its graduates in various fields.
